发明名称 Process for applying a carbonaceous coating onto a surface
摘要 The surface of a material is covered with a carbonaceous coating by vacuum deposition, the carbon in a substantially pure form originating from a hydrocarbon gas plasma. The surface to be coated is coupled to a source of direct current operating at a frequency of less than 500 kHz, at which the electrical impedance of the plasma does not vary appreciably during the deposition process. As the impedance of the plasma is substantially constant, the process is reliable and reproducible. It can be performed without dynamic control and without adjustment and it does not require any adapter of impedance between the source of alternating current and the vacuum chamber. It has been found that frequencies in the range 300-400 kHz with voltages of the order of 1 kV or more have given good results. The coatings obtained are intended chiefly for reducing the reflectivity of optical substrates. <IMAGE>
